Common Signs of Stress in Snakes

Recognizing stress in your snake early can prevent serious health complications down the line. Snakes don’t vocalize discomfort the way other pets do, so you’ll need to watch for subtle behavioral and physical changes.

Here are five key stress indicators every snake keeper should know.

Loss of Appetite and Feeding Changes

loss of appetite and feeding changes

Appetite suppression ranks among the most reliable stress signs you’ll observe in captive snakes. When environmental conditions falter—improper temperature gradients, humidity fluctuations, or handling frequency—feeding refusal emerges in 40–70% of affected individuals.

Stress-induced anorexia disrupts digestive efficiency and triggers nutrition deficits, with recovery typically requiring 1–3 weeks once you correct underlying feeding problems and restore ideal snake health parameters.

Abnormal Hiding and Escape Behaviors

abnormal hiding and escape behaviors

Beyond appetite loss, you’ll notice stressed snakes retreating into hiding spots for extended periods—refuge-seeking behavior that can increase by 40% when enclosure setup or environmental enrichment falls short. Abnormal hiding patterns often pair with frantic escape tactics: rapid sprinting, tunnel-like dashes when approached, and repeated relocation attempts.

Defensive Postures and Aggression

defensive postures and aggression

When your snake shifts from hiding to active defense, you’re witnessing escalated stress signs that demand attention. Defensive posturing—coiling tightly, hissing, lunging, or striking—reflects aggression triggers tied to perceived threats. Studies show 72% of captive snakes display threat response behaviors when confined with incompatible species, and stress biomarkers like corticosterone spike by 41% within four weeks.

Watch for these defensive mechanisms:

  • Coiled body with raised head or S-curve stance
  • Hissing, rattling, or audible breathing during approach
  • Strike attempts or bite behaviors toward handlers
  • Persistent all-up posture displays after disturbances

These attack behaviors signal your snake’s urgent need for environmental adjustment.

Irregular Shedding and Skin Changes

irregular shedding and skin changes

Defensive displays often precede physical stress indicators—look at your snake’s skin. Irregular molt cycles, incomplete sheds around the eyes or tail, and dermatitis causes like chronic dryness all signal shedding problems rooted in environmental imbalance.

Research shows 18% of snakes exposed to fluctuating humidity develop erratic shedding patterns, with skin lesions appearing in 9% of cases. These shedding disorders compromise epidermal health and reptile health overall.

Unusual Body Movements or Posturing

unusual body movements or posturing

Watch for tremors, repetitive head bobbing, or jerking movements—these body language stress indicators reveal significant distress. Snakes showing prolonged abnormal posturing during inspections often have elevated stress biomarkers, while those exhibiting quivering musculature face a 28% higher risk of subsequent anorexia.

Recognizing snake stress through these movement patterns and behavioral cues allows you to intervene before clinical illness develops.

Environmental Causes of Snake Stress

environmental causes of snake stress

Your snake’s enclosure isn’t just a container—it’s the foundation of their health. When environmental conditions drift from what their species needs, stress builds silently until physical symptoms appear.

Let’s break down the key environmental factors that put captive snakes at risk.

Improper Temperature Gradients

When your enclosure setup lacks proper thermal gradients, you’re setting your snake up for chronic thermal stress. Temperature control isn’t optional—60% of captive reptiles face heat gradient gaps that trigger stress markers within two weeks. Here’s what proper gradient management demands:

  1. Maintain 10°C or less between basking sites and cool zones to prevent irregular shedding
  2. Standardize gradients within species ranges to cut stress behaviors by 50%
  3. Monitor dusk-to-night transitions when temperature fluctuations spike feeding problems by 30–40%

Humidity Fluctuations

Beyond temperature gradients, humidity control directly impacts snake hydration and respiratory health. When humidity levels swing from 40% to 80% within a day, you’re triggering a 1.7-fold spike in stress hormones. Rapid fluctuations cut feeding response by 28% and drive respiratory issues up 14%.

Environmental stability demands humidity monitoring—keep most species between 45–60% relative humidity to prevent these documented stressors.

Inadequate Hiding Spots and Shelter

Your snake’s hiding spot availability directly influences stress levels—studies show that 12% of captive snakes lack a single suitable hide, which drives stress behaviors up 38%. You need at least two hides per snake: one on the warm side, one on cool.

Shelter material matters too—foam hides yielded 18% higher occupancy than ceramic. Spatial complexity and enclosure layout with opaque, properly fitted hiding spots reduce defensive responses by 24% during routine handling.

Noise, Vibrations, and Lighting Disturbances

Subtle environmental disruptions—noise pollution, vibrational stress, and irregular lighting cycles—trigger measurable stress signs in your snake. Auditory distress from ambient noise over 40 dB raises cortisol by 23%, while low-frequency vibrations increase displacement behaviors by 18%. Consider these environmental factors for effective stress management:

  • Ambient noise exceeding 60 dB elevates escape attempts by 32%
  • Floor vibrations raise heart rate variability by 11%
  • Irregular lighting cycles reduce feeding frequency 8–12%
  • Consistent amber night lighting improves appetite by 8%

Overcrowding and Incompatible Species

Housing multiple snakes together—even compatible species—often backfires. Multi-species enclosures report chronic stress signs in 5.9% of captive snakes versus 2.1% in single-species setups, while inter-species aggression jumps 43% with two or more species.

Overcrowding risks extend beyond behavior: inadequate enclosure size creates competing microclimates, disrupting proper temperature regulation.

Your snake care strategy should prioritize species compatibility and appropriate coexistence strategies for ideal animal welfare.

Preventing and Reducing Stress in Snakes

preventing and reducing stress in snakes

Preventing stress in your snake isn’t about reacting to problems—it’s about building an environment where stress never gets a foothold in the first place. You have more control than you might think, and small adjustments to your husbandry practices can make a massive difference in your snake’s long-term health.

Preventing snake stress means building an environment where problems never take root, not just reacting when they appear

Let’s break down the essential strategies that keep stress at bay and give your snake the stable, secure life it needs.

Optimizing Temperature and Humidity

With Environmental Stability at the heart of snake health, you’ll want to dial in Thermal Gradients and Humidity Control. Use Temperature Monitoring to keep gradients within a 10–15°C range and humidity levels stable—abrupt shifts trigger stress.

Microclimate Design, like multiple heat sources, lets your snake choose comfort zones, minimizing stress from poor enclosure setup or unpredictable environmental factors.

Providing Appropriate Enclosure Design

Beyond temperature and humidity, your enclosure setup shapes your snake’s daily experience. Enclosure Size matters—larger, well-structured housing with proper Substrate Depth (at least 3–5 cm) and Visual Barriers cuts stress behaviors by 33%.

Ventilation Systems prevent stagnant air while maintaining humidity levels.

Multiple hiding spots across temperature gradients let your snake self-regulate, reducing defensive postures by 25% in controlled studies.

Enrichment and Hiding Opportunities

Enrichment and hiding opportunities directly support your snake’s natural behaviors. Multiple discreet hides—ideally cork, vegetation, or bark—reduce stress by 22% and boost shelter use by up to 28%.

Varied substrate variety and enclosure layout create microhabitats your snake can explore, improving body condition.

Environmental enrichment with visual barriers and transitional zones between open and covered areas cuts defensive behaviors by 18%, letting your snake feel secure while encouraging healthy exploration.

Minimizing Handling and External Stressors

Once your snake’s enclosure delivers security and enrichment, handling techniques become your next stress management priority. Strategic handling stress reduction means:

  1. Limit sessions to 5–10 minutes, 1–2 times weekly
  2. Skip handling during shed cycles or feeding windows
  3. Use slow, deliberate movements—no sudden reaches

Staff training on proper handling techniques cuts acute stress responses by 15–20%, protecting your snake’s long-term health and calming methods that actually work.

Routine Observation and Health Monitoring

Weekly health checks catch stress indicators before they escalate into serious health issues. Track feeding response, shed quality, and activity patterns in a simple log—changes in snake behavior often signal trouble 10–25% earlier than visible symptoms.

Monitoring tools like digital thermometers and humidity gauges provide objective data, while recognizing snake stress through routine observation promotes better reptile health outcomes and timely veterinary guidance when patterns shift.

When to Seek Veterinary Care for Stress

when to seek veterinary care for stress

You can manage most stress in snakes through environmental adjustments and proper husbandry, but some situations demand professional veterinary intervention.

Recognizing when stress has progressed beyond your ability to correct it at home protects your snake from serious health complications. Watch for these red flags that signal it’s time to consult a reptile veterinarian.

Persistent Behavioral or Physical Symptoms

When behavioral changes or physical symptoms persist beyond 2–3 weeks, you’re likely dealing with chronic stress that won’t resolve on its own. Watch for these health issues that demand veterinary attention:

  1. Continuous refusal to feed spanning multiple weeks
  2. Ongoing defensive postures despite environmental corrections
  3. Repeated regurgitation or digestive disturbances
  4. Persistent abnormal shedding cycles
  5. Sustained lethargy paired with physiological responses like elevated respiration

Unexplained Weight Loss or Anorexia

Weight loss beyond 5–15% of body mass within a month signals serious trouble. Anorexia causes tied to stress indicators like improper temperatures or humidity can trigger feeding problems that spiral into hepatic lipidosis—especially in pythons and boas with high fat reserves. Weight management demands immediate intervention when appetite suppressants (environmental stressors) persist, since nutrition therapy can’t work until the underlying health issues are corrected.

Timeframe Weight Loss (%) Clinical Action
1–2 weeks 3–5% Monitor closely, adjust temps
3–4 weeks 5–10% Veterinary consult recommended
1–2 months 10–15% Urgent care; nutritional support
2–3 months 15–20% Critical; risk of hepatic disease
>3 months >20% Severe; guarded prognosis

Chronic Illnesses or Repeated Shedding Problems

Persistent conditions don’t resolve themselves—they demand professional intervention. Chronic anorexia affects 22–60% of stressed captives, while shedding disorders plague up to 30%. You can’t ignore stress biomarkers when immune suppression opens the door to respiratory or skin infections.

Effective reptile care and management requires veterinary expertise to address:

  1. Recurrent incomplete sheds linked to environmental deficiencies
  2. Ongoing weight loss despite stress reduction techniques
  3. Elevated cortisol (1.5–3-fold baseline increases)
  4. Persistent infections from immune suppression
  5. Nutritional imbalances affecting snake health and wellness

Frequently Asked Questions (FAQs)

Can stress in snakes be reversed completely?

Complete stress reversal in snakes isn’t guaranteed—recovery depends on species, stress duration, and environmental enrichment. Early intervention optimizes reptile welfare, yet chronic stress can leave lasting physiological traces despite thorough stress reduction techniques.

Do different snake species react differently to stress?

Yes, stress thresholds and behavioral responses vary markedly by taxon. Ball pythons react more quickly to thermal shifts than corn snakes, while boas show longer recovery times after handling compared to colubrids.

How long does recovery from stress typically take?

Recovery timeframes for snake stress vary by species and severity. Most snakes show behavioral improvement within 1–3 weeks after environmental adjustments, while full physiological recovery often requires 2–6 weeks with proper stress management.

Are baby snakes more vulnerable to stress than adults?

Hatchlings aren’t just small adults—they’re wired differently. Juvenile development involves heightened stress thresholds, elevated corticosterone levels, and accelerated telomere shortening.

Growth impacts compound when environmental factors, hiding spots, or defensive behaviors trigger persistent shedding problems.

Can stressed snakes transmit illness to other reptiles?

Stress doesn’t directly transmit illness between snakes. However, immune suppression from chronic stress increases vulnerability to opportunistic infections.

Strict biosecurity measures—quarantine protocols, dedicated equipment, and proper husbandry—prevent disease vectors from spreading in multi-reptile environments.
